Exports (% of GDP) in the Solomon Islands in 2024 — 40.57%. Ranked 78 in the world out of 172. Since 1980, the indicator has fallen by 6.88 pp.

About the indicator

Exports of goods and services as a percent of GDP — a measure of how far an economy is oriented toward external markets. In small open economies and transit hubs the indicator can exceed 100% of GDP: exports are counted at the full value of the goods while GDP is counted as value added, so re-exports and assembly production inflate the figure.
